Description

An affidavit is based upon either the personal knowledge of the affiant or his or her information and belief. Personal knowledge is the recognition of particular facts by either direct observation or experience. Information and belief is what the affiant feels he or she can state as true, although not based on firsthand knowledge.



An affidavit is a written statement of facts voluntarily made by an affiant under an oath or affirmation administered by a person authorized to do so by law.

Do you solemnly swear that the statements in this document are true to the best of your knowledge and belief, so help you God? The verbal wording for an affirmation for a jurat is as follows: Do you solemnly affirm that the statements in this document are true to the best of your knowledge and belief?

In plain language the jurat certificate says that Jack Signer was in the presence of Sam Notary. Jack swore (or affirmed) to the truthfulness of the document. (In other words, Jack took an oath/affirmation.) It also says that the Jack Signer "subscribed to" the document "before me." "Me" means Sam Notary.

A notary acknowledgement ensures that the signer of the document is indeed the person named in the document. The function of the notary in this case is to verify the identity of the signer. On the other hand, a notary is asked to perform a Jurat, when the signer takes an oath or makes an affirmation.

The purpose of an acknowledgement is for an affiant, whose identity has been verified, to declare to a notary public that he or she has willingly signed an affidavit. An acknowledgment requires the following steps: The signer must physically appear before you.

The purpose of a jurat is for an affiant to swear to or affirm the truthfulness of the contents of an affidavit. A notary public administers an oath or affirmation to the affiant, who verifies the truths listed in the affidavit under penalty of perjury.
